A Closer Look at Tencent Music Entertainment Group
In the ever-evolving landscape of music streaming, Tencent Music Entertainment Group (NYSE:TME) occupies a significant position. With major public companies owning 61% of its shares, the implications extend beyond mere financial metrics—they tell a story of influence, legacy, and future directions for the industry.
Understanding Shareholder Dynamics
According to recent reports, institutions own about 28% of the company, highlighting a blend of support from both corporate giants and institutional investors. This ownership structure is reflective of the broader music industry, where large public companies often dominate.
